1. Unique User Interface
One of the distinguishing factors of Windows Phone 8 is its unique user interface. Instead of the traditional grid of icons, Windows Phone 8 employs a tile-based interface known as Live Tiles. These live tiles display real-time information and updates from apps without the need to open them. Users can customize these tiles according to their preference, making it easy to access essential information at a glance. With its modern and visually appealing design, the user interface of Windows Phone 8 offers a refreshing and intuitive experience.

3. Enhanced Security and Privacy
Windows Phone 8 takes security and privacy seriously. The operating system comes with built-in security features such as Secure Boot, which ensures that the device only runs trusted software. Additionally, Windows Phone 8 supports encryption of user data, keeping personal information safe from unauthorized access. Users also have granular control over app permissions, allowing them to decide which apps have access to their data and resources. With its robust security features, Windows Phone 8 provides users with peace of mind and a sense of control over their digital lives.
